Crime overview

Ruskin Avenue area has the 12th highest crime rate of 25 local areas in Magdalen , and the 144th highest crime rate of 331 local areas in Great Yarmouth .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Ruskin Avenue (NR31 7HD) in the last 12 months was 78.2 per 1,000 residents and was 4.8% lower than the Magdalen average (82.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 5 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Drugs 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 5 (≈ 20.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-28.6%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-71.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Ruskin Avenue (NR31 7HD), the highest concentration of overall crime is near St Edmund Close, where police recorded 14 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Wadham Close (6 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
